Dodatkowo opowiem o pozosta\u0142ych popularnych nierelacyjnych systemach przetwarzania danych.<\/p>\n\n\n\n<p><strong>Date<\/strong>: 12.01.2018<br><strong>Place<\/strong>: Sala\u00a0447\u00a010:15<br><strong>Subject<\/strong>: Propozycja prostego modelu wzrostu mikrostruktur z zawiesiny cz\u0105stek.<br><strong>Person<\/strong>: <em>Tomasz Wysocza\u0144ski<\/em><br><strong>Abstract<\/strong>: [Seminarium robocze] Na seminarium chcia\u0142bym zaprezentowa\u0107 pomys\u0142 wzgl\u0119dnie prostego modelu budowania mikrostruktur przy pomocy si\u0142y dielektroforetycznej. Przedstawi\u0119 szczeg\u00f3\u0142y modelu, jego dzia\u0142anie oraz parametry. Ponadto om\u00f3wi\u0119 otrzymane wyniki, por\u00f3wnuj\u0105c je z obserwacjami eksperymentalnymi. Pokr\u00f3tce o modelu: przedstawia on zawiesin\u0119 cz\u0105stek (budulca) oraz mikroelektrody. Uk\u0142ad zdefiniowany jest na sieci kwadratowej. Cz\u0105stki i elektrody s\u0105 opisywane przez zaj\u0119te w\u0119z\u0142y tej sieci. Ruch cz\u0105stek jest realizowany przez losowe przej\u015bcia mi\u0119dzy s\u0105siednimi w\u0119z\u0142ami. Budowanie struktury polega na do\u0142\u0105czaniu cz\u0105stek do elektrody, je\u017celi dojdzie do kolizji cz\u0105stka-elektroda (podobnie jak w agregacji ograniczonej dyfuzj\u0105). Zar\u00f3wno na ruch cz\u0105stek, jak i przy\u0142\u0105czenie do elektrod narzucone zosta\u0142y dodatkowe warunki, maj\u0105ce odzwierciedli\u0107 dzia\u0142anie si\u0142y dielektroforetycznej.<\/p>\n<\/div><\/div><\/div><\/div><\/div><\/div>\n<\/div><\/div><\/div><\/div><\/div><\/div>\n","protected":false},"excerpt":{"rendered":"<p>Date: 19.11.2021Place: Room\u00a0119\u00a010:15Subject: Rozwi\u0105zywanie r\u00f3wna\u0144 Maxwella w strukturach dielektrycznychPerson: Andrzej Szczepkowicz, Dmytro Konakhovych, Damian \u015anie\u017cekAbstract: Chocia\u017c r\u00f3wnania Maxwella maj\u0105 ju\u017c 150 lat, to na u\u017cytek wsp\u00f3\u0142czesnej techniki wci\u0105\u017c poszukuje si\u0119 nowych ich rozwi\u0105za\u0144; poszukuje si\u0119 tak\u017ce nowych struktur optycznych, dla kt\u00f3rych istniej\u0105 po\u017c\u0105dane typy rozwi\u0105za\u0144.
